Opera 98.0.4759.1 Crack & Serial Key [Latest-2023]

Opera 98.0.4759.1 Crack & Serial Key [Latest-2023]: Opera 98.0.4759.1 Crack & Serial Key Free Download 2023 Opera 98.0.4759.1 Crack & Serial Key Free Download 2023 Opera 98.0.4759.1 Crack

Comments

Popular posts from this blog